Essential Functions:
- Performs accounting and auditing assignments under the direction of the partner or manager, including the preparation of financial statements, and work papers.
- Performs review procedures as assigned by supervisors. Completes engagements of moderate complexity with an emphasis on quality standards, timely completion within budget, and profitability. Keeps the partners and managers informed of all important developments on engagement, analyzes problems, and recommends solutions.
- Assists partners and managers in resolving client issues and problems; compiles research and prepares reports on various audit or financial issues.
- Attend meetings with clients and have direct interaction.
- Performs other accounting and auditing duties as needed in engagements as assigned by supervisory personnel.
Required licenses, Certificates, or Knowledge
- Actively working towards obtaining a CA Certified Public Accountants (CPA) License.
- Educational requirements for CPA license met at graduation preferred (to be full-time eligible) or plan to complete. (150 units and required courses).
- Demonstrated communication skills, both written and verbal, to effectively interface will all levels of Firm management and staff, clients, and outside business contacts.
- Demonstrated use of computers, computer accounting software, and tax software programs preferred.
- Travel may be required for audit engagements or to main office in Bakersfield, CA.
